Although opinions are mixed as to timing for reopening various segments of the global economy, Florida is movign forward with a phased reopening of Disney Springs that will begin on May 20, 2020.
According to Disney, they are following guidance of government and health officials and are moving forward with a limited number of shopping and dining experiences that are owned by third-party operating participants to begin opening during this initial phase. The rest of Walt Disney World Resort will remain closed, including theme parks and resort hotels.
Additional details from Disney follow below.
As we continue to monitor conditions, and with the health of guests and Disney cast members at the forefront of our planning, we are making several operational changes. Disney Springs will begin to reopen in a way that incorporates enhanced safety measures, including increased cleaning procedures, the use of appropriate face coverings by both cast members and guests, limited-contact guest services and additional safety training for cast members.
We will apply learnings and ideas from leaders in the health and travel industries, and we’re also talking to our unions as we prepare for some cast members to return to work.
During the initial opening phase, Disney Springs will have limitations on capacity, parking and operating hours. Given this unprecedented situation, we appreciate everyone’s patience and understanding as we navigate through this process as responsibly as we can. Additional protocols and procedures may be announced closer to the opening date.
